Jeremy Meeks, Hot Mugshot Guy, Speaks: I’m Married, I’m Not a “Kingpin”

The so-called mugshot guy speaks! Jeremy Meeks, a convicted felon whose hot mugshot went viral this week, spoke out from jail regarding his incarceration on Thursday, June 19. Speaking to ABC’s local affiliate in Sacramento, Calif., Meeks said that he learned of his sudden Internet popularity after chatting with his wife.

“Well I appreciate [the attention],” Meeks, 30, wearing an orange jumpsuit, told a reporter from behind a glass wall. Shaking his head and smiling, he added: “But I just want them to know that this is really not me, I’m not some kingpin.”

Meeks’ mugshot set the Internet ablaze after the Stockton Police Department posted his picture to its Facebook page on Wednesday, June 18. Meeks and four others were arrested in a gang-related bust, dubbed Operation Ceasefire, a combined effort between federal and local police authorities to halt a recent surge in robberies and shootings in the city.

His mother Katherine Angier, though, insisted Friday, June 20, that her son is no longer a gang man. “Please help,” Angier wrote of her son’s bail, which was posted at $900,000. “My son was taken into custody on his way to work. He is a working man with a son. He is being stereotyped due to old tattoos.”

Angier included sweet snapshots of Meeks with his 3-year-old son in her plea, which hopes to raise $25,000. “He’s my son and he is so sweet,” she wrote alongside the snapshots. “Please help him to get a fair trial or else he’ll be railroaded.” As of Friday afternoon, she’s raised $418.

Meeks’ sister told TMZ on Friday that the only reason why Meeks was armed at the time of his arrest was for protection purposes. She told the outlet that her brother has been a practicing Christian for seven years. Meeks, according to TMZ, has been married to his wife (the mother of his little boy) for four years.

Jeremy Meeks’ mugshot has attracted more than 50,000 likes and 5,500 shares on Facebook since it was posted on Wednesday. “I have not seen that many likes for a photo before,” Stockton PD spokesman Officer Joseph Silva said Thursday, June 19.

Stockton PD spokesman Joseph Silva told the Associated Press that Meeks is no model. In fact, he’s “one of the most violent criminals in the Stockton area.” According to the police department, Meeks spent nine years in prison for grand theft.

Meeks is scheduled to be arraigned Friday, June 20.
